Prepare various motions and notices such as motions for clerk and court defaults, motions for summary judgment, and final judgments of foreclosure.
Prepare various affidavits such as affidavits of indebtedness and affidavits of military status.
Scheduling and confirming hearings and mediations.
E-file via the California Court’s E-filing Portals.
Update client systems such as BKFS, Tempo and ADR.
Submit documents for client review and execution.
Run SCRA & PACER searches at various milestones.
